Provider Score in 15641, Hyde Park, Pennsylvania

The Provider Score for the Overall Health Score in 15641, Hyde Park, Pennsylvania is 66 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

An estimate of 96.95 percent of the residents in 15641 has some form of health insurance. 42.68 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 71.75 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ase. Military veterans should know that percent of the residents in the ZIP Code of 15641 have VA health insurance. Also, percent of the residents receive TRICARE.

For the 111 residents under the age of 18, there is an estimate of 0 pediatricians in a 20-mile radius of 15641. An estimate of 2 geriatricians or physicians who focus on the elderly who can serve the 86 residents over the age of 65 years.

In a 20-mile radius, there are 2,050 health care providers accessible to residents in 15641, Hyde Park, Pennsylvania.

**Physician-to-Patient Ratio and Primary Care Availability:**

A fundamental indicator of community health is the physician-to-patient ratio. Determining the exact ratio for 15641 requires accessing up-to-date data from sources like the U.S. Department of Health & Human Services and state medical boards. However, based on available information, rural areas often face challenges in this regard. The relative isolation of Hyde Park, while offering scenic beauty, may contribute to a lower physician density compared to more urbanized areas. This can translate to longer wait times for appointments and potentially limited choices for patients.

Primary care availability is inextricably linked to the physician-to-patient ratio. Primary care physicians (PCPs) serve as the gatekeepers of healthcare, providing preventative care, managing chronic conditions, and coordinating specialist referrals. The presence of a robust primary care network is crucial for maintaining overall community health. In Hyde Park, assessing primary care availability involves identifying the number of PCPs, including family physicians, internists, and pediatricians, practicing within the ZIP code or in close proximity.

**Telemedicine Adoption and its Impact:**

Telemedicine, the use of technology to deliver healthcare remotely, has gained significant prominence, particularly in rural areas. The adoption of telemedicine by healthcare providers in 15641 can significantly improve access to care, especially for those with mobility issues or transportation challenges. Telemedicine offers several benefits, including virtual consultations, remote monitoring of chronic conditions, and access to specialists who may not be locally available.

Assessing the extent of telemedicine adoption requires identifying which practices offer virtual appointments, remote monitoring capabilities, and other telehealth services. The availability of reliable internet access in the community is also a critical factor. Without adequate internet connectivity, telemedicine's potential benefits cannot be fully realized.

**Mental Health Resources: A Critical Component:**

Mental health is an integral aspect of overall health. The availability and accessibility of mental health resources within the 15641 ZIP code are crucial. This includes identifying the number of psychiatrists, psychologists, therapists, and counselors practicing in the area. The presence of mental health clinics, support groups, and crisis intervention services is also vital.

The integration of mental health services into primary care settings is another important consideration. This integrated approach can improve access to mental health care by reducing the stigma associated with seeking help and making it easier for patients to receive comprehensive care. Furthermore, awareness of local resources, including crisis hotlines and support groups, is essential.
